Key Industries Benefiting from Allen Key Imperial Socket Sets
Allen Key Imperial socket sets are crucial in several sectors due to their design that facilitates ease of use in tight spaces where standard wrenches cannot reach. Some of the primary industries that rely heavily on these tools include:
- Automotive: In automotive repair and manufacturing, these socket sets are used for assembling engines and body parts, as well as in the installation of interiors.
- Manufacturing: Various manufacturing machinery and assembly lines require frequent adjustments and tightening of equipment, which are made simpler and faster with the use of socket sets.
- Aerospace: Precision is paramount in the aerospace industry, and Allen Key Imperial socket sets are employed for the meticulous assembly of parts that demand high accuracy.
- Construction: Socket sets are used in the construction industry for metal framework assembly, where robust tools are needed to handle heavy-duty materials.
- Electronics: In smaller scales such as in electronics, these tools help in the assembly of components in confined spaces without causing damage to delicate parts.
How to Use Socket Sets (Allen Key Imperial) in the Automotive Industry
The use of Allen Key Imperial socket sets in the automotive industry is indicative of the tools' indispensability. Here s how professionals utilize these tools in automotive applications:
- Selecting the Correct Size: Begin by selecting the correct size of the Allen socket for the task. This is crucial to ensure that the tool fits perfectly with the bolt or screw, preventing stripping or damage.
- Attachment to Wrench: Attach the selected Allen socket to a compatible wrench. For best results, use a ratchet wrench that allows you to work in tight spaces and provides the necessary torque.
- Application: Place the socket onto the screw or bolt head and turn the wrench. Ensure steady pressure to maintain grip and avoid slipping off the bolt during fastening or unfastening operations.
- Checking Work: Once tightened or removed, double-check the bolt or nut to ensure it's secure or completely disengaged, respectively.
